The Best Barbecue Cooking Techniques And Tips

Barbecuing procedures

On the subject of barbecuing, many of us merely stick the meat on the grill and wait for it to cook.

This is whats called the ‘direct grilling’ technique.

And when if we’re nervous about offering undercooked meat in that case there’s always the temptation to wait until it’s black on the outside beforehead of deciding on that it’s done.

Regrettably this method doesn’t constantly lead to the most delicious final results.

There are plenty of different ways that you can cook using a barbecue and many of them produce a lot more tasty results than simply plonking the meat on the flame.

Hence always be bold and also test out some of the following methods:

Indirect grilling

If grilling with a bbq, a lot of people put the meat onto the rack directly over the coals – this is called ‘direct grilling’.

There is an option called ‘indirect grilling’ which often can give excellent success.

Indirect grilling means pushing the hot coals to one side of the bbq and setting your food on the other side, in order that the hot coals are not beneath the food.

This method resembles roasting within a conventional stove and therefore needs a tiny bit longer compared to direct grilling however is wonderful for cooking larger joints of meat, or for cooking things like sausages which frequently burn on the outside prior to they are cooked in the centre.

It also ensures that as the cook, you don’t have to keep turning the actual meat or perhaps be worried about it burning above the hot coals.

To work with this indirect barbecuing technique, light your bbq in the regular method and when the coals are ho and also have turned white, push them to one side of your bbq with a appropriate barbecue tool.

Locate your spill tray on the other side of the bbq (to trap all fat that drips from the meat) and put this meat over the actual drip tray.

Close the cover of the barbecue and cook for the needed time frame, turning when necessary.

Smoking

Smoking food using a bbq makes an exceptional great smoky taste and you can invest in ‘smokers’ especially for this.

On the other hand, you can utilize your traditional bbq for smoking, providing it features a lid.

It needs you to create a great smoky atmosphere within the bbq so your smoke circulates around the meat.

To accomplish this, saturate a big handful of wood chips in cold water for at least 30 minutes

Drain your wood chips and put all of them at the center of a large piece of aluminum foil and fold the aluminum foil over the wood chips to make a bag.

Next, stab a number of holes in the tin foil pouch; this will allow the smoke to escape.

Place your aluminum foil pouch in your barbecue, directly on the top of hot coals.

When the wood starts to smoke, put your meat onto the oiled rack, close the lid and cook for any required time.

Steaming

Steaming is a good method to cook seafood over a barbecue as it keeps the actual flesh delightfully moist and stops it from falling about the smoker.

This technique works well with salmon fillets but is good for other forms of fish and will even be used for cooking mussels.

In order to steam food on your bbq, have a sheet of tinfoil big enough to make a bag all over your piece of fish.

Lightly oil one side of your tinfoil, put the fish in the middle and drizzle with marinade, if using.

Fold the tinfoil loosely around the seafood to give your steam space to flow and seal the sides over solidly to avoid the steam from getting away.

Put the tinfoil package on your barbecue and cook for any required time for that particular recipe or piece of fish.

Braising

Braising means to gently brown meat or vegetables in fat before cooking gradually inside a closed pot with a little water.

You can do this on a barbecue by simply browning the meat or vegetables directly on the barbecue grill ahead of adding to the actual pan along with your liquid.

Then you’re able to position the pot on the barbecue to cook, providing that the pot may resist the heat. If not, or perhaps if you are restricted for room, you can always brown the meat on the bbq after which complete the process utilizing a traditional hob.

Spatchcock

Spatchcock is a method used for cooking chicken especially chicken nonetheless it can be utilized for alternative birds such as poussin as well as quail.

The great thing about spatchcock is the fact that it means that you can cook an entire chicken on the barbecue pretty quickly and simply.

You can request your butcher to prepare your chickenen geared up for cooking or you can do it yourself.

Just, place the chicken, breast-side down, over a firm work surface and look for its spine.

Trim entirely along both sides of the backbone and remove the backbone. Next, flip the chicken over and press down to flatten as well as open it out.

Coat the chicken in an oily marinade (lemon, oil and garlic works well) to add taste and stop it from sticking before putting it on the bbq.

Cooking periods is determined by how big the bird and also the heat of your barbecue but once carried out, your chicken should be slightly crisp on the outside and any kind of red juices must have entirely vanished from the inside.

Prime Selection’s Cooking Ideas: Korean Barbecue Beef Marinade!

Prime Selection’s Cooking Ideas: Korean Barbecue Beef Marinade!

This beef marinade recipe, makes a great meal that’s guaranteed to leave you yearning for more, and for the most flavor, try using Kobe beef rib eye steaks.

Biochemistry tests by Washington State University on wagyu fat, (Wagyu Kobe Beef), indicate that the fat from this breed has a healthier fatty acid profile. In addition, this breed also has an unsaturated-to-saturated fat ratio of 2-to-1, instead of 1-to-1, which is characteristic of regular beef.

Ingredients:
2 rib eye steaks, thinly sliced
2 tablepoons soy sauce
2 teaspoons sesame oil
2 teaspoons crushed garlic
2 tablespoons brown sugar
1 tablespoon rice wine (sake)
Pinch of black pepper
1/2 piece of fresh kiwi, juiced in a blender
Dipping Sauce:
1 tablespoon soybean paste
2 teaspoons crushed garlic
2 teaspoons red pepper sauce
1 teaspoon salad oil
2 tablespoons water

]]>

Instructions:
1. Trim the fat off the beef with a knife. Distribute the sugar evenly on the beef by sprinkling it on each piece. Allow beef to sit for 10 minutes.
2. In a separate bowl, mix together the soy sauce, sesame oil, garlic, sugar, sake, and black pepper. Put aside.
3. Massage the beef with the kiwi juice using your hands. The kiwi works as a tenderizer. Add the soy sauce mixture and mix. Allow the beef to marinate for 10 minutes. Because the beef is thin, it doesn’t require a long marinating time. Now it is ready to be barbecued. Ideal if grilled over smoked wood but just as good in a frying pan or skillet. Cook until browned, being careful not to overcook.
4. Last, to prepare dipping sauce, combine all sauce ingredients and cook over low heat for 15 to 20 minutes. Serve on the side.

Servings: 3 to 4

Cooking with a Wood Fired Barbecue

Cooking with a Wood Fired Barbecue

Long before the advent of charcoal briquettes and propane people were cooking their meals over wood fueled fires. From the days of cave-men to less than one hundred years ago wood was the fuel of choice when it came to cooking. In this modern age we are constantly looking for a faster, cleaner and easier way to do everything, including preparing our meals. This has led to the development of bigger accessory laden gas fueled grills lining the isles of home improvement stores and showing up in our backyards. But for the barbeque purists out there nothing tastes quite the same as preparing their favorite barbeque dish over a wood fired grill. Why is this? What could possibly work better then the latest and greatest in barbecue technology? Depending on the type of wood used the “Grill-Master” (that guy who hovers over the grill creating barbecue master pieces) can create flavors in the meat, poultry or fish that just cannot be had over a more modern gas fueled grill. This flavor can further be adjusted just by the amount of wood used, how hot the fire is, and how much smoke the meat is allowed to marinate in. There are several types of wood fired barbeques on the market today. They are sometimes referred to as smoker grills. The offset firebox is the one most of us are used to seeing. These come in all sizes, from small family sized units to large trailer born monsters capable of feeding several hundred people. The distinguishing characteristic of the offset firebox is, well the offset firebox. Set off to the side and slightly below the main cooking chamber is the firebox. This separates the food from direct heat and allows for a nice slow cooking temperature. The bullet style smoker is not actually a smoker but more of what is called a cold smoker or water smoker. They use a pan of water between the heat source and the meat, thereby blocking any direct heat that would cause any overcooking. In a sense they are not really considered a barbecue because of the way they work. The main chamber cooker is the third type of wood fired barbeque. These are barrel shaped and allow the fire to be built off to one side with the meat offset from the wood allowing for an indirect cooking method. You do need to be careful with how large of a fire gets built because there is no physical separation between the heat source and the meat. The fire need to be kept small and tended in a timely manner throughout the cooking process. Of course all this is a moot point if you do not select the right type of wood. For a wood fired barbecue nothing works better than a fruit bearing hardwood such as oak, hickory, pecan, maple apple and of course from Texas mesquite. Do not use softwoods or the wood from evergreens or conifers. Aside from burning at a lower temperature they are loaded with sap which will leave a bad taste on anything you cook. Cooking meat over a wood fire has been something humans have been doing for thousands of years. With the newer and more modern wood barbecue smokers on the market today it is possible for just about anyone to enjoy real wood fired barbecue.

Cooking Barbecue Ribs in a Blizzard

Cooking Barbecue Ribs in a Blizzard

There are times when you just have to have that rack of barbecue ribs. Maybe they have been sitting in your freezer since fall and you just can’t wait any longer, you just have to have those ribs. But with the cold of winter set in getting out to the grill is more of an exercise in survival, making it hard to truly enjoy the barbecue experience. Throw in some snow and wind and the idea of cooking ribs on the grill goes out the door.

Now if your are truly hardcore you can put on your snow boots, bundle up in hat, coat and gloves, shovel a path out to the grill, get it lit and hope the wind doesn’t blow it out. The next part may be even trickier; actually grilling the ribs. While barbecue ribs aren’t all that hard to make they do need constant attention. Standing outside in the cold and wind can make this difficult not to mention that it’s either getting dark out or the sun has already gone down. Grilling in the dark, even with a flashlight, is not easy because it’s hard to tell if and when the ribs are done.

Now this doesn’t mean it can’t be done because many a hard core griller has endured the elements to fix their favorite barbecue dish. But if this isn’t you’re idea of barbecue fun then there is an alternative. If you have a large crock pot or pot you can put on the stove you can be enjoying tender barbecue ribs in a few hours.

Here’s how you do it.

Get your crock pot or large pot set up. Pour in some barbecue sauce then set your ribs in the sauce. You may have to cut your ribs into sections if you are doing a rack of baby back ribs. Pour the rest of the sauce over the ribs making sure to cover them well. You want to cook them slowly so don’t turn the stove up to high. With a crock pot set them to high to get the temperature up and then turn them down to low and let them simmer.

By cooking your ribs slow you are looking at letting them cook for two to three hours, or even longer. The flavors of the sauce will work deep into the meat leaving it moist and tender. It will also fill your house with the smell of barbecue, which is good if you like that kind of thing.

While this isn’t exactly the same as cooking barbecue ribs on a grill it is a great way to enjoy the taste of barbecue even on the coldest of winter nights.

2 Must-Know Myths About Barbecue Cooking

2 Must-Know Myths About Barbecue Cooking

Nothing can be described as a more enjoyable event during summer than a barbecue party. If you cook it properly, chances are you’ll find a great delight with the after-cooking results. However, many people fall into the trap of believing some barbecue myths that give a hindrance to fine barbecuing. This article provides details about barbecue myths that a barbecue lover must know about.

Myth 1: Poking and flipping can cause your BBQ to go bad

Poking or flipping your food materials on grill can make it hard. Well, this is the most common myth that most people follow because they think it’s going to ruin their barbecue dishes. In order to achieve the ideal grill lines on your barbecued items, you need to flip it to make sure that the lines can be even on both sides. Most people can get this technique right because they believe in that common myth. What they don’t know is that flipping the meat can help in cooking it evenly from both sides while adding perfect grill lines on it.

Bonus tip on how to cook the perfect BBQ

You can get much information either online or in books that contain guidelines and secrets in creating the best barbecue. What you need to do is to make sure that it is a reliable source. Some details can be proven helpful but others maybe just an overstated opinion that came from the author.

Myth 2: Poking and flipping will cause the BBQ to lose its “juice”

It is a myth that all the juices of the meat will go out leaving it hard when you poke or flip it. Hundreds of tiny cells containing their own juices and moisture compose a meat. If you happen to poke a meat with a fork, it doesn’t mean that all the juices will ooze out. A fork is not much of a sharp object and with this you can only “puncture” about one or two cells while still leaving the meat full of moisture and juice. On the other hand, what you need to avoid is repeatedly stabbing the meat with a fork while cooking, which means you’ll pop out every cell leaving it tough and dry.

What you need to avoid is squeezing the meat after flipping it with a spatula, as the grease goes out and so does the juice. This will certainly leave your meat hard and dry.

So the next time you’re off to a barbecue event, don’t be afraid of poking and flipping. Create those perfect grill lines; it can make your guests and family delighted when you’ve come up with a great barbecue dish!

Super Bowl Chicken Chili

A delicious, aromatic, and ridiculously great tasting Chili !

HERE’S WHAT YOU’LL NEED:

food dog 0161 Super Bowl Chicken Chili

Ingredients:

  • 2 lbs Ground Chicken
  • 1 cup Salsa
  • 1/2 cup chopped FRESH Cilantro
  • 1 large Onion chopped
  • 2 cloves minced Garlic
  • 6 cups Chicken Broth
  • 1 lb dry White Beans
  • 2 tbsp chopped Jalapeno peppers
  • 1 -  5 oz can Tomato Paste
  • 1 – 14 oz can Chili or Spicy style Tomatoes
  • 3 tbsp Olive Oil
  • 3 tbsp Butter
  • 1 tbsp each – Cumin, Smoked Paprika, Oregano
  • Salt and Pepper to taste. I used approx. 1 tsp each.

Optional Toppings:

  • Fritos Corn Chips
  • Shredded Cheese
  • Sour Cream

Directions:

  • Cover and soak beans in water overnight.

  • Heat pot over medium heat , then add oil.
  • To hot oil, add garlic and onion and saute till translucent (3 – 5 minutes)

  • add butter and chicken. Stir and saute until chicken is no longer translucent.
  • add Cumin, Paprika, Oregano, Salt and Pepper, and stir continuously for 1 minute.

  • add beans, canned tomatoes, salsa, broth, tomato paste, jalapeno, cilantro, mix well.
  • simmer over med-low heat 1 hour, or until beans are soft.
